I am feeling pretty amazing. I started the Couch to 5K beginner running program on the 11th February. I have always wanted to be a runner for no other reason than it always seemed like the pinacle of fitness and far too hard for me. I've tried and failed at many points during my life to be a runner, generally weighing a lot less than I do now too. I finished C25K program on the 1st April :) I love running so much I have continued and just finished my longest run ever today - an 8km trail run up and down hill! Not too shabby for a 195lb fat lady :smile:
